Nevada Municipal Airport (KNVD) — Quick Facts
- Location: Nevada, Missouri (Vernon County)
- Runway 18/36: 4,001 × 75 ft — Asphalt, good condition
- Elevation: 892 ft MSL
- Approaches: RNAV GPS approaches
- Fuel: 100LL available

Nevada Hangar Project Considerations
- Airport coordination: Work with city airport management on site selection and lease
- FAA review: Structures require FAA Form 7460-1 airspace analysis
- Vernon County permits: Building permits and inspections required
- Foundation design: Aircraft floor loads require proper slab engineering
- Utility connections: Plan for electrical service and potential water/sewer
